コードで説明するのが一番です:
| | a | b | c | d | row-total |
|----------------+----+-----+----+--------+-----------|
| check-sum | 4 | 5 | 7 | 1000 | |
|----------------+----+-----+----+--------+-----------|
| | 1 | 2 | 2 | 1 | |
| | 3 | 4 | 5 | 6 | |
|----------------+----+-----+----+--------+-----------|
| calculated-sum | ok | (1) | ok | (-993) | |
|----------------+----+-----+----+--------+-----------|
#+TBLFM: @>$<<..$>>='(let ((sum (apply '+ '(@II..@-1))) (expected @2)) (if (= sum expected) "ok" (format "(%s)" (- sum expected))));N
集計行 (@5) が正常に動作しています。最後の列 (行 @2..@4) で各行の値を合計したいと思います。それをどう表現するか。